Output 81cd32d07780c434a115566f36648805fbf1f23aa076b65dd059862c86f9d6c1:1

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 358620d4dd3e20132d4d01bbd2b6f85a7230d6f5
address
tb1qxkrzp4xa8cspxt2dqxaa9dhctferp4h4rqchk7
transaction
81cd32d07780c434a115566f36648805fbf1f23aa076b65dd059862c86f9d6c1